Introduction
The HPE MSL Tape Library integration monitors HPE MSL tape libraries via the Command View Tape Library (CVTL) REST API, discovers tape libraries, drives, tapes, and backup hosts, and collects metrics for library status, drive health, capacity planning, and tape utilization.

Key Use Cases
Discovery Use Cases
- Discovers 5 resource types such as HPE CVTL Manager, HPE MSL Library, HPE MSL Drive, HPE MSL Tape, and HPE MSL Host.
- Publishes relationships between resources to provide a topological view.

Monitoring Use Cases
- Publishes 56 metrics across categories such as Availability, Performance, Usage.
- Supports threshold-based alerting for metrics where alerting is enabled in the workbook.
Supported Target Versions
- HPE MSL6480, MSL3040, MSL2024 tape libraries with CVTL REST API enabled.
- CVTL API versions supporting /rest/cvtl/ and /rest/index/ endpoints.
